Every second and fourth Saturday of the month, the Downtown Fort Walton Beach Saturday Market sets up at Landing Park along the scenic Choctawhatchee Bay from 8 AM to 1 PM. Local farmers bring fresh produce, vendors offer artisan foods from specialty pickles to handmade baked goods, and crafters display coastal art and handmade jewelry. The bayfront location with water views and easy walkability to downtown FWB makes this a refreshing morning stop that feels genuinely local. It runs year-round, rain or shine.
